Anyone see it ? Impressive stuff, in case you didnt know its a special development from Litchfields / Powerstation in Tewksbury.

415 bhp, 0-60 in 3.8 seconds and more importantly easy to live with as a day to day driver.

40k though, cheaper than a supercar for sure but an awful lot of money for a Subaru..

Post by: Bartop on November 10, 2006, 10:49:54 AM
Quote from: NosYou cant fit 3 friends in an Atom though  8)

You probably wouldnt want to take 3 friends with you round the track though ;)

For me it doesnt add up if
a) Youre after an out and out track car -  cheaper faster alternatives available
b) You not tracking and 40k is your budget for your main car - not enough prestige

It only works if
a) You are a die hard Subaru fan and want the ultimate Impreza
b) You have the exotica already and want a practical car for day to day
c) You want a fast practical road car which you can take to the track occasionally.
